The Basics: What You’re Actually Changing When You Convert a Gasoline Vehicle to Electric

Converting a gasoline car to electric isn’t about "adding" an electric motor it’s about replacing the entire powertrain. Here’s a breakdown of the key components that get swapped out or added:

Key Fact: Not All Cars Are Equal

Some vehicles are better suited for conversion than others. Rear-wheel-drive cars with a simple chassis (like the Toyota Corolla, Volkswagen Beetle, or Honda Civic) are the easiest to work with. Front-wheel-drive cars require more modification, while luxury vehicles with complex electronics can be challenging and costly.

Step 4: Install the Electric Components

  1. Mount the Motor: Secure it to the chassis or transmission mount points. For direct drive systems, connect it directly to the differential.
  2. Install the Battery Pack: Place batteries in a sealed, ventilated compartment, often in the trunk or where the fuel tank was located. Ensure proper weight distribution to maintain handling.
  3. Wire the System: Connect the battery pack to the controller, motor, charging system, and dashboard. Use high-gauge copper wiring rated for high voltage (typically 48-96V).
  4. Add Cooling & Safety Features: Install a liquid cooling system for the battery, and add fuses, circuit breakers, and a fire suppression system as extra precautions.

Legal & Regulatory Considerations for Electric Conversions in Nigeria

Converting a gasoline vehicle to electric isn’t just a mechanical project – you need to ensure you’re compliant with Nigerian laws:

  1. Registration & Certification: You must submit your converted vehicle to the NADDC for testing and obtain a Certificate of Roadworthiness. The FRSC will then issue a new registration plate indicating it’s an electric vehicle.
  2. Insurance: Most major insurance companies in Nigeria (like AIICO and Leadway) now offer specialized policies for converted electric vehicles. Premiums are typically 10-15% lower than for gasoline cars due to lower maintenance risks.
  3. Charging Infrastructure: While home charging is allowed, public charging stations require approval from the Nigerian Electricity Regulatory Commission (NERC). Lagos currently has 32 public charging stations, with plans to add 100 more by 2027.
  4. Tax Incentives: The Nigerian government offers a 50% reduction in import duties for electric vehicle components and a 2-year exemption from road taxes for converted vehicles.

Key Fact: Future Regulations

The NADDC is developing a national standard for electric vehicle conversions, which will set minimum safety requirements and ensure consistency across workshops. This is expected to be implemented by the end of 2026, making conversions more accessible and regulated.
